A cctv system serves mainly as a security force multiplier, providing surveillance for a larger area, more of the time, than would be feasible with security personnel alone.

If guardians church members, greeters or private security officers can limit access first to your parking lots and then to your sanctuary, you will have established the first and second tiers or layers of security protocols.
